Top 25 Muslim Girl Names with Meanings

# Name Meaning
1AaliyahExalted, noble, high-ranking
2FatimaCaptivating, daughter of Prophet ﷺ
3AishaAlive, prosperous, wife of Prophet ﷺ
4ZainabFather’s precious jewel, daughter of Prophet ﷺ
5MaryamPious, pure, mother of Prophet Isa (AS)
6HudaGuidance
7NoorLight, radiance
8AmiraPrincess, leader
9KhadijaEarly baby, first wife of Prophet ﷺ
10SumayaHigh above, exalted
11YasminJasmine flower
12LinaTender, delicate
13SarahPure, noble lady
14HafsaGatherer, wife of Prophet ﷺ
15InayaCare, concern
16SafiyaBest friend, pure
17AreebaWise, intelligent
18LaylaNight, beauty of the night
19RaniaQueenly, gazing
20IqraRead, recite (first Quranic word)
21AyatVerses (of the Quran), sign of God
22NuraLight, luminous
23ZoyaLoving and caring
24MalikaQueen
25SamiraEntertaining companion, storyteller
